Is there a way to have conditional data validation based on the contents of another cell in Google spreadsheets?

Exam sheet: https://docs.google.com/spreadsheet/ccc?key=0ApUbvdjb2dQUdDRIbWVxX25JR29BZHItYXdHZkR2T3c&usp=sharing

I am wondering if there is a way for cell J2 to be determined by the contents of M2, so that only a certain range of numbers (time) can be entered in J2 based on M2? The ranges would be this: if M2 says β€œlow,” then J2 should be between 1 hour and 200 hours. If this warning does not appear or it does not allow you to enter (either / or) ...

  • Low = 1: 00: 00-200: 00: 00 (1-200 hours)
  • Average = 200: 00: 01-300: 00: 00 (200-300 hours)
  • High = 300: 00: 01-500: 00: 00 (300-500 hours)

Is it possible?
